Yiayia: Time-perfected Recipes from Greece’s Grandmothers showcases regional Greek cookery and features sharing and feasting dishes, mainly vegetarian, from the kitchens of grandmothers across Greece.
Think Stuffed Courgettes from Lesvos, a Cycladic Fourtalia, Corfiot spicy Bourdeto Stew, Ionian pasta dishes, Cretan Dakos salad, Watermelon Cake from Milos.Yiayia maps out the diverse dishes of Greece — far beyond the most commonly-known Moussaka, Greek Salad, and Tzatziki dip – through the fascinating recipes and stories of its Yiayiades.
Follow Anastasia's journey through Greece as each yiayia welcomes you into their home – cook with them in their kitchen, learn their time-perfected techniques and read the memories that season this book. With stunning location photography and heartwarming interviews, you can discover the true food of Greece and the characterful grandmothers behind beaded curtains in white-washed homes.

Recent years have seen dramatic changes to the events industry. The
influence of social media and global communications technology,
increased focus on environmental sustainably and social
responsibility, and changes to the economic and cultural landscape
have driven rapid expansion and increased competition. Special
Events: Creating and Sustaining a New World for Celebration has
been the event planner's essential guide for three decades,
providing comprehensive coverage of the theory, concepts and
practice of event management. The new Eighth Edition continues to
be the definitive guide for creating, organizing, promoting, and
managing special events of all kinds. Authors, Seungwon "Shawn" Lee
and Joe Goldblatt, internationally-recognized leaders and educators
in the industry, guide readers through all the aspects of
professional event planning with their broad understanding of
diverse cultures and business sectors. This definitive resource
enables current and future event leaders to stretch the boundaries
of the profession and meaningfully impact individuals,
organizations, and cultures around the globe. Global case studies
of high-profile events, such as the PyeongChang Winter Olympic
Games and Norway's Constitution Day annual event, complement
discussions of contemporary issues surrounding safety, security,
and risk management. Each chapter includes "Ecologic," "Techview,"
and/or "Secureview," mini-case studies, a glossary of terms,
plentiful charts, graphs, and illustrations, and links to
additional online resources.

From award-winning actor and food obsessive Stanley Tucci comes an intimate and charming memoir of life in and out of the kitchen. For Stanley and foodie fans, this is the perfect, irresistible gift.
Before Stanley Tucci became a household name with The Devil Wears Prada, The Hunger Games, and the perfect Negroni, he grew up in an Italian American family that spent every night around the table. He shared the magic of those meals with us in The Tucci Cookbook and The Tucci Table, and now he takes us beyond the recipes and into the stories behind them.
Taste is a reflection on the intersection of food and life, filled with anecdotes about growing up in Westchester, New York, preparing for and filming the foodie films Big Night and Julie & Julia, falling in love over dinner, and teaming up with his wife to create conversation-starting meals for their children. Each morsel of this gastronomic journey through good times and bad, five-star meals and burnt dishes, is as heartfelt and delicious as the last.
Written with Stanley's signature wry humour and nostalgia, Taste is a heartwarming read that will be irresistible for anyone who knows the power of a home-cooked meal.
